Miguel Cotto has his opponent picked for December 1st in Madison Square Garden. His opponent will be against undefeated up and comer Austin “No Doubt” Trout. Trout has an undefeated record of 25 wins 14 by knockout and a goose egg in the loss column. Miguel Cotto will be Austin’s toughest opponent to date and a huge threat to his undefeated record. Trout of course hopes for an upset which will be huge for his career if he is to pull it off.

After facing one undefeated fighter Cotto is to move on to the next. After his loss in Las Vegas against the undefeated Mayweather Jr. Miguel wanted to headline his own bout in his favorite venue, Madison Square Garden. Miguel Cotto will be teaming up with Golden Boy Promotions for this event. Miguel Cotto will be self promoting the event under his own promotion label.

If Saul “Canelo” Alvarez wins and Cotto wins this event Oscar De La Hoya has been hinting at a Cotto vs. Alvarez match-up. Now with Cotto also teaming with Golden Boy this is starting to look like a reality. This reality will probably come true in 2013 of course. Another Golden Boy rumor was Canelo will also fight one more time after his September 15th date. That would mean Canelo to fight in December before the year is over. This fight has not been scheduled for Pay-Per-View yet and is still in talks with HBO and Showtime. Add Canelo to the undercard this can be a very exciting event and possible PPV card.
